Simplify DB test/upgrade tool (#27141)
This PR simplifies the `test/upgrade` tool the QA team uses to test DB
upgrades.

- Removes "online migration" approach because we currently don't support
it (so it removes nginx as dependency).
- Adds a workflow to manually run this on Github actions (in case dev/QA
folks have issues with Docker on macOS, which is a common thing...)
- Adds logging to the output to ease troubleshoot (previous versions was
too quiet making it impossible to troubleshoot).

# This workflow can be used to test DB upgrades between two Fleet versions.
name: DB upgrade test
on:
workflow_dispatch: # allow manual action
inputs:
from-version:
description: "Docker tag of Fleet starting version, e.g. 'v4.64.2'"
required: true
type: string
to-version:
description: "Docker tag of Fleet version to upgrade to, e.g. 'rc-minor-fleet-v4.65.0'"
required: true
type: string
defaults:
run:
# fail-fast using bash -eo pipefail. See https://docs.github.com/en/actions/using-workflows/workflow-syntax-for-github-actions#exit-codes-and-error-action-preference
shell: bash
permissions:
contents: read
jobs:
run-db-upgrade-test: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- name: Harden Runner
uses: step-security/harden-runner@63c24ba6bd7ba022e95695ff85de572c04a18142 # v2.7.0
with:
egress-policy: audit
- name: Checkout Code
uses: actions/checkout@629c2de402a417ea7690ca6ce3f33229e27606a5 # v2
- name: Install Go
uses: actions/setup-go@93397bea11091df50f3d7e59dc26a7711a8bcfbe # v4.1.0
with:
go-version-file: 'go.mod'
- name: Run upgrade test
run: |
cd test/upgrade
FLEET_VERSION_A=${{ github.event.inputs.from-version }} FLEET_VERSION_B=${{ github.event.inputs.to-version }} go test -v
